New movie

See the film I Am Not a Serial Killer. In a small town in the midwestern US, John Wayne Cleaver (Max Records) is a troubled 16-year-old struggling with homicidal tendencies and an obsession with death. When a serial killer begins terrorising his town, Cleaver must keep his feelings in check as he hunts down the killer to protect those around him. The film is based on the 2009 novel of the same name by Dan Wells. Drama, also starring Christopher Lloyd, Laura Fraser, Karl Geary and Matt Roy.

Get tickets now for Jordi Savall – Ibn Battuta: The Voyager of Islam II, Travels Through India and China. As part of the Abu Dhabi Classics series, the musician returns to the capital, with performers from India and China, to present a sequel based on the music that the traveller Ibn Battuta heard during his visits to royal courts, palaces, public places and small villages. Readings from Ibn Battuta's travel journal will compliment the performances.
